M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E, also known as MUTHOOT is a Private, established in 2013. Located in Ernakulam, M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E campus spans over Around 14 acres. The college is affiliated to APJ Abdul Kalam Technological University and recognized by the AICTE approved. M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E is ranked 251-300 by NIRF under Engineering in 2022. NIRF ranking: 251-300
M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E offers a wide range of various programs in the streams of Engineering. B.Tech, M.Tech, MCA are some of the popular courses. Admissions at M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E are based on Merit and KEAM scores. The college accepts KEAM for B.Tech, GATE and state-level exams for M.Tech. For placements, MUTHOOT IN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Y AND SCIENCE placement rate is Approximately 80%%. During the placement drive of 2024, the highest salary package offered was INR ₹12 LPA LPA and the average package stood at INR ₹4.5 LPA LPA.

Undergraduate Programs
| Course Name | Specializations | Duration | Eligibility | Seat Intake |
| B.Tech | Civil Engineering |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| Computer Science & Engineering |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 120 seats |
| B.Tech | Electronics & Communication Engineering |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| Electrical & Electronics Engineering |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| Mechanical Engineering |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| CSE (Artificial Intelligence) |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| Artificial Intelligence & Data Science |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
| B.Tech | Cyber Security | 4 years | 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ics | 60 seats |
Postgraduate Programs
| M.Tech | Artificial Intelligence & Data Science | 2 years | B.Tech in relevant field | 12 seats |
| M.Tech | Cyber Security | 2 years | B.Tech in relevant field | 12 seats |
| MCA | Master of Computer Applications | 2 years | Bachelor’s degree in relevant field | 60 seats |

The placement cell at MITS works closely with top companies to ensure students secure promising career opportunities. As per MITS placements 2024, 562 students got placed. The highest package offered for MITS placements 2024 was 12 LPA and the average package offered was 4.5 LPA. Some of the top MITS recruiters included TCS, Infosys, Wipro, Microsoft, Cognizant, Deloitte.

The Around 14 -acre campus provides students with a conducive learning environment equipped with modern facilities.
Facility | Details |
Campus Area | Spanning 14 -acres with modern infrastructure |
Library | Houses 14,000+ physical books, including 1,500 reference titles, 1,500 DVDs, and subscriptions to 60+ technical journals and magazines. Offers group study zones and IP-based electronic resource access. |
Laboratories | Equipped with state-of-the-art labs for all disciplines to support practical learning and research |
Hostels | Separate hostels for boys and girls with a capacity of 490+ students |
Sports Facilities | Includes both indoor and outdoor games, such as basketball, badminton, volleyball, cricket, and a gym |
Green Campus | Eco-friendly environment with green initiatives for sustainability |
Tech-Enabled Classrooms | Smart classrooms with advanced teaching aids, including projectors and internet access |
